Oppenheimer (OPY) recently released its officially filed Q1 2025 earnings results, marking the latest operational update for the global financial services firm. The reported adjusted ear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ter came in at $2.72, while consolidated revenue metrics were not included in the publicly released earnings materials at the time of this analysis. Management Commentary

Management commentary shared during the associated Q1 2025 earnings call focused on broad operational trends, rather than granular financial performance details in the absence of public revenue disclosures. Leadership highlighted ongoing investments in digital wealth management tools for both retail and high-net-worth clients, noting that these investments are intended to improve client retention and expand access to the firm’s advisory services for underserved market segments. Management also addressed cross-firm cost control initiatives implemented in recent months, noting that these efforts may have supported the reported EPS performance for the quarter. Leadership further noted that market conditions for financial services firms remained mixed through the quarter, with heightened volatility in public equity markets potentially impacting trading revenue and investment banking deal flow, though specific financial impacts of these trends were not quantified in the public commentary. Forward Guidance

OPY’s management did not provide formal quantitative forward guidance for future operating periods as part of the Q1 2025 earnings release, consistent with the firm’s standard reporting practice for this quarter. They did offer qualitative insights into potential operational priorities moving forward, including planned expansion of the firm’s sustainable investing product offerings to meet growing client demand for ESG-aligned investment solutions. Management also noted that they would continue to monitor macroeconomic conditions, including interest rate trends and broader capital market activity, to adjust operational and investment strategies as needed. Analysts estimate that any potential shifts in interest rate policy in the upcoming months could impact OPY’s net interest income from wealth management client holdings, though no firm projections for this or other line items have been confirmed by the company. Market Reaction

Following the release of the Q1 2025 earnings, trading in OPY shares saw normal trading activity in initial post-announcement sessions, with no extreme price swings observed in the first hours after the filing was published. Market analysts have noted that the lack of published revenue data has led to delayed formal rating updates from many sell-side research teams, who are waiting for full financial disclosures before updating their outlooks on the stock. Some market participants have highlighted the reported EPS figure as a potential positive signal of the firm’s ability to control costs amid uncertain market conditions, though this view is not universal across analyst teams. Trading volume in OPY remained near average levels in the sessions following the earnings release, suggesting that market participants are taking a wait-and-see approach ahead of additional financial disclosures from the company.
